Sports betting is legal in some states for a long time, but not in others. The 1992 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act prohibited sports betting in the United States, however it exempted states that have existing frameworks for sports betting. In 2018, Murphy v. National Collegiate Athletic Association overturned PASPA. Legalized sports betting is now legal in some states. These websites let you place bets.
